Common Mold Remediation Scams in Kountze

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

Urgent Health Scare

Scammers exaggerate mold risks to your health, pushing for immediate full-home treatment without proper testing.

🚫

Deposit and Dash

They demand a hefty deposit for 'materials' then disappear without starting work.

🚫

Bait-and-Switch

Super-low inspection quote balloons into thousands for remediation after 'discovering' widespread issues.

🚫

Fake Testing

Uses bogus tests to 'prove' severe mold, selling unnecessary services.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Request a current certificate of insurance (COI) for general liability and workers' compensation. Call the insurer directly using the contact on the COI to confirm coverage.

2

Licensing

Texas requires mold remediation contractors to be licensed by the Department of State Health Services (DSHS). Ask for their license number and verify it on the official DSHS website lookup tool.

3

References

Ask for 3+ recent references from Kountze or Hardin County jobs. Call them to verify the work quality, timeliness, and if mold returned.

Protection FAQs

What licenses are required for mold remediation in Texas?

Contractors need a DSHS license for mold remediation. Always verify the number on the state DSHS website.

Should I pay upfront for mold removal?

Limit to a small deposit (10-20%). Pay the rest upon completion or in verified stages.

How do I verify insurance?

Get the COI and call the listed insurer to confirm it's active and covers the job scope.

Is door-to-door mold service legit?

Usually not. Red flag – seek licensed pros through trusted referrals or matching services.

Do I need a separate mold inspector?

Yes, for unbiased assessment. Remediators may have conflicts of interest.

What if I've been scammed?

Report to Texas AG, local BBB, and Hardin County consumer protection. Dispute charges with your bank.
